The objective of this study is to measure the breastfeeding success for all preterm and term newborns in our department of neonatology during the hospital stay and at the age of six months.

Prospective Inquiry of Breastfeeding Success at the Department of Neonatology of University Hospital of Cologne and Analysis of Influencing Factors
